North Charleston - White House hopeful Barack Obama joked on Thursday he would name billionaire talk show host Oprah Winfrey vice president if Democrats picked him for the top spot on the ballot.
In a tongue-in-cheek chat with comedian David Letterman on his late night talk show, Obama also said he would name Republican presidential candidate Mitt Romney "Secretary of Good Taste", in non-partisans deference to Romney's elegance.
Obama promised to rename the 10th month of the year "Barack-tober" and to reintroduce at the White House a correct pronunciation of the word "nuclear", which President George W Bush invariably mangled.
The joke about Winfrey was a loaded one, since the United States television talk show diva had boosted Obama's White House hopes by openly endorsing him, bringing her celebrity wattage and the attention of her millions of fans to his campaign.
Winfrey appeared with Obama at several campaign stops in Iowa, which he won, and in South Carolina, which hold its Democratic primary on Saturday.
